Departing from Nagoya Station, the bus travels north along the Tokai-Hokuriku Expressway, heading towards the majestic mountains. Your first stop is Hirayu on the Alpine Seaway, where you'll enjoy a steaming, delicious Japanese pork shabu-shabu lunch in the crisp mountain air. After lunch, the journey continues to the famous Shin-Hotaka Ropeway. Ascend to over 2,000 meters in altitude on Japan's only double-decker cable car. A breathtaking panoramic view of snow-capped peaks will unfold before you – an unforgettable experience amidst the winter beauty of the mountains. With fond memories of this stunning scenery, the bus returns to Nagoya Station along the Tokai-Hokuriku Expressway. This day trip offers a rich and memorable mountain getaway experience.
